MTN Cybersecurity Incident: Customers Urged to Stay Vigilant Amid Ongoing Investigations

April 29, 2025
in Vaultz Business
Reading Time: 3 mins read
0

MTN Group has confirmed that it recently experienced a cybersecurity incident affecting its systems.

While all platforms remain fully operational and no major service disruptions have occurred, the telecommunications giant has initiated a forensic investigation to assess the full scope of the breach. Early indications suggest that the personal data of approximately 5,700 MTN Ghana customers may have been compromised.

The company assured customers and stakeholders that the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of its systems remain a top priority. MTN emphasized that despite the incident, its operations are running smoothly, and proactive measures are being taken to address the situation swiftly and effectively.

In a public statement, MTN Ghana noted, “We are mindful that our stakeholders may have concerns. While at this early stage of the investigation, we have not been able to ascertain the full extent of the incident, early indications are that about 5,700 MTN Ghana customers’ data may have been affected. We will contact the customers involved.”

MTN Working Closely With Leading Cybersecurity Experts

To contain the incident and safeguard against further exposure, MTN is working closely with leading cybersecurity experts. The ongoing forensic investigation is being conducted in line with established security protocols, and the company is devoting the necessary resources to resolve the matter. Though the exact nature of the compromised data has not been fully disclosed, MTN is taking all necessary steps to mitigate potential risks.

In light of the situation, MTN is urging its customers to remain alert and take proactive steps to protect their personal information. The company has issued the following security guidelines:

  • Customers are advised to place a fraud alert on their credit reports with major credit bureaus to mitigate any possible fraudulent activities.
  • All MTN, MoMo (Mobile Money), and banking apps and devices should be kept up to date with the latest security patches and software updates.
  • Users should employ strong and unique passwords across accounts and change them regularly.
  • Customers should be cautious of unexpected messages, especially those containing links or requesting sensitive information.
  • It is crucial not to disclose passwords, PINs, or One-Time Passwords (OTPs) in response to phone calls, text messages, or emails.
  • Where available, customers are encouraged to activate multi-factor authentication for an added layer of security.

Commitment To Protecting Customer Privacy

MTN has reiterated its unwavering commitment to protecting customer privacy and maintaining the trust it has built with its user base over the years. “The privacy of information is our top priority, and we remain committed to safeguarding the integrity of our systems and the trust placed in us by our customers and other stakeholders. We will continue to contain and manage this matter carefully,” the company stated.

The telecom leader acknowledged the potential concerns such incidents might generate, especially in an age where data breaches have become increasingly common. MTN has committed to providing regular updates and guidance to affected individuals and the general public as more details become available.

Customers who suspect any suspicious activity or need further assistance are encouraged to contact MTN’s customer care team. The company’s support team is available to provide information and address any questions through its toll-free number, 100.
